Common Causes of Nest Cam Outdoor Live View Problems

Before diving into fixes, it helps to understand what's behind your Nest Cam Outdoor live view not working issue. The most frequent culprits include weak Wi-Fi signal at the camera's mounting location, outdated Nest app or firmware, power supply interruptions, and network configuration conflicts. Outdoor cameras face additional challenges from weather exposure, distance from your router, and interference from other devices. Identifying the root cause will save you time and prevent the problem from recurring.

Step-by-Step Troubleshooting Guide

Follow these steps in order. Test your live view after each one to see if the issue resolves before moving to the next.

1
Check Your Wi-Fi Signal Strength: Open the Nest app and tap your camera, then tap the gear icon and select "Technical Info." Look for the Wi-Fi signal strength reading. If it shows "Weak" or the RSSI is below -67 dBm, your camera isn't getting reliable connectivity. Try moving your router closer, adding a Wi-Fi extender, or repositioning the Cam Outdoor to reduce obstacles like thick walls or metal siding.
2
Restart Your Nest Cam Outdoor: Unplug the camera's power adapter from the outlet, wait 10 seconds, then plug it back in. The status light will turn blue during startup. Wait approximately 2 minutes for the camera to fully reconnect to your network, then test live view again. A simple restart clears temporary glitches that commonly disrupt streaming.
3
Update the Nest App and Camera Firmware: Visit your phone's app store and ensure you're running the latest Nest or Google Home app version. For firmware, open the app, select your camera, go to Settings > Technical Info, and check if an update is pending. Install any available updates, as outdated software frequently causes Nest Cam Outdoor live view not working problems with newer devices and security protocols.
4
Verify Power Supply Integrity: Inspect the entire cable run from outlet to camera. Look for fraying, moisture in connections, or damage from rodents or landscaping equipment. The Nest Cam Outdoor requires a stable 5V/2A supply; voltage drops from long extension cords or damaged cables cause intermittent live view failures. Test with a different known-good outlet and cable if you suspect power issues.
5
Check Bandwidth and Network Settings: Run a speed test near your camera's location—you need at least 2 Mbps upload speed for reliable live view. Log into your router and confirm you're using a 2.4 GHz network (Nest Cam Outdoor doesn't support 5 GHz). Disable AP isolation, verify ports 1935 and 443 aren't blocked, and ensure your network isn't bandwidth-saturated by streaming, gaming, or large downloads.
6
Remove and Re-Add the Camera: In the Nest app, go to Settings > Remove Device for your Cam Outdoor. Factory reset the camera by pressing and holding the reset button on the cable connector for 12 seconds until you hear a chime. Re-add it through the app's setup flow, scanning the QR code on the camera base. This resolves configuration corruption that standard restarts can't fix.
Important: Do not perform a factory reset until you've exhausted other options, as this erases your video history and all custom settings including zones and schedules. If your camera is under Nest Aware subscription, your cloud history remains accessible through the web interface, but local settings will need complete reconfiguration.

Advanced Solutions for Persistent Issues

If you're still experiencing Nest Cam Outdoor live view not working after completing all basic steps, consider these advanced approaches. Switch your router's Wi-Fi channel to 1, 6, or 11 to minimize interference from neighboring networks. Enable QoS (Quality of Service) settings to prioritize your camera's traffic. If you recently changed your Wi-Fi password or router, the camera may be attempting to connect with stale credentials—a full removal and re-addition becomes essential. For homes with mesh networks, ensure the camera connects to the nearest node rather than a distant one; some systems allow you to "pin" devices to specific access points in their management apps.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why does my Nest Cam Outdoor live view work sometimes but not others?

Intermittent live view typically indicates borderline Wi-Fi signal strength or network congestion. The camera may maintain enough connection for status updates but fail to sustain the higher bandwidth required for streaming. Check your signal during peak usage hours and consider upgrading your internet plan or adding a dedicated outdoor access point.

Can weather affect my Nest Cam Outdoor live view?

Yes, though the camera is weather-resistant, extreme temperatures can temporarily impact performance. Heavy rain or snow can absorb Wi-Fi signals, and moisture in cable connections causes electrical issues. Ensure all connections use the included weatherproofing materials, and verify your operating temperature range (-4°F to 104°F) isn't being exceeded.

Will switching from the Nest app to Google Home fix my live view problem?

Google has migrated Nest devices to the Google Home app, and the legacy Nest app receives fewer updates. While switching won't fix hardware or network issues, the Google Home app may offer better compatibility with newer phone operating systems and improved streaming protocols. Download Google Home and migrate your device to see if performance improves.
